400 Lonely Things – Subdivisions (2025; Unexplained Sounds Group) – Avant Music News


400 Lonely Things is an ongoing musical effort that is very difficult to nail down or categorize. Its shimmering soundscapes employ experimental ambient music, but most tracks include repeating rhythmic structures. Some add synthesized beats and muted voiceovers that give Subdivisions an odd catchiness.

Nonetheless, the album evolves over 12 tracks of varying lengths, with all under 10 minutes. Flute-based or piano melodies combine with static and field recordings of nature. Echoing themes evoke a sense of disquiet. Rumbling bass, samples, and scattered electronic loops have a similar result. While a diverse set of instrumentation and sounds are represented, none dominate the mix. This gives each track a unique feel despite the aforementioned repetitiveness.

In its enigmatic blend of brightness and disorientation, Subdivisions becomes an intriguingly layered experience. Although it could easily be used as a soundtrack for moments of cinematic horror, the album’s defining quality lies more in its hypnotic ambiguity than in straightforward gloominess. Turning up the volume reveals intricate sonic details, inviting repeated exploration and deeper immersion into 400 Lonely Things’ uniquely crafted atmospheres.
